Retail Manager: Cost of hiring?
- Common salary in Darwin, Northern Territory: $69,800 yearly
- Typical salaries range from $56,538 – $86,173 yearly
*Indeed data (AU)

What's the average time to fill a retail manager role?
The average time to fill a retail manager role is 26 days, calculated from the moment the job is posted until a candidate accepts the offer.
What skills do retail managers tend to have?
According to the candidates available on Smart Sourcing, the most common skills for a retail manager include: customer service, retail sales and time management.
What licenses or certifications are common for a retail manager?
Common licenses or certifications for retail managers include: Driver Licence, RSA and First Aid Certification.
